Research Abstract

In this study, it was indicated that some kinds of component cells in periodontal tissue have receptors for pain and factors known to inhibit pain. The date in this study suggested the possibility that the component cells in periodontal tissue secrete inhibitors for osteoclastogenesis. Moreover, this study suggested that a factor, which is known to differentiate periodontal ligament cells into cementoblasts, has the ability to control inflammation and immunity.
